Страница 1 из 1
M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-11 18:33:53
sergey2140
Всем доброго дня.
Помогите, пожалуйста, в решении следующей проблемы. Есть сервер, ОС FreeBSD 7.3. С помощью MPD5 подключаюсь к провайдеру через 2 сетевые карты, получаю 2 PPPoE интерфейса. Нужно поднять на том же MPD два L2TP туннеля к моему серверу. Но поднять нужно один туннель по одному PPPoE соединению.
Т.е. вопрос в том как указать MPD по какому именно интерфейсу поднимать соединение.
Адреса, выдаваемые провайдером - динамические. Адрес сервера для подключения - статика.
Проблем с файрволом и NATом пока касаться не будем.
Спасибо.
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 17:02:49
sergey2140
Так что - вариантов нет?
Я понимаю конечно, что можно сделать подключения по порядку: pppoe1 - l2tp1 - pppoe2 - l2tp2. Но если будет сбой по одному из каналов - оба соединения пойдут по другому каналу... Может быть для создания туннеля стоит использовать не MPD, а какую-то другую систему?
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 17:11:26
Гость
десять раз перечитал и нихрена не понял
пишите понятнее
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 17:13:25
sergey2140
Ок. Как указать MPD поднимать l2tp на определенном интерфейсе?
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 17:17:08
Гость
никак, потому что это неимеет смысла, сто раз уже обсуждалось
обьясните зачем l2tp привязывать к какому то интерфейсу?
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 17:19:19
sergey2140
Гость писал(а):никак, потому что это неимеет смысла, сто раз уже обсуждалось
обьясните зачем l2tp привязывать к какому то интерфейсу?
Для того, чтобы по разным каналам поднять разные туннели.
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 17:22:07
Гость
ну и причем здесь сами интерфейсы?
можете хоть как то графически изобразить?
а то я не доганяю что вы там такое хотите закрутить
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 17:35:27
sergey2140
Гость писал(а):ну и причем здесь сами интерфейсы?
можете хоть как то графически изобразить?
а то я не доганяю что вы там такое хотите закрутить
Есть 2 сетевые платы, re0 и re1. На них поднимается 2 pppoe соединения, ng0 и ng1. По каждому из соединений нужно поднять l2tp туннель - ng2 и ng3. По умолчанию, туннели будут подниматься на интерфейсе, который выбран интерфейсом по умолчанию. Мне нужно, чтобы туннель ng2 был поднят на интерфейсе ng0, а туннель ng3 - на ng1.
Графически рисовать не обучен, извиняйте.
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 17:44:01
Гость
ненадо меня цитировать
слева внизу есть кнопочка - ответить
вам в pppoe выдаются динамические адресса или статически эти адресса уже привязаны у провайдера для коннекта?
l2tp есть опция peer, взависимости от того куда направлен роут, будут коннектится и l2tp линки
а роуты направляются по поднятию pppoe линков, соотвественно сриптами up можно правильно направлять маршрут и соотвественно направлять l2tp линки
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 17:55:52
schizoid
а зачем то 2 l2tp туннеля? чем один слушая все интерфесы не устроит?
ложиться один канал, пусть клиент подключается на второй...
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 18:20:49
sergey2140
В pppoe выдаются динамические адреса, к сожалению.
Мысль с изменением роутинга понял, примерно представил себе реализацию. Это то, что мне было нужно, огромное вам спасибо!

Re: MPD. Два PPPoE соединения и два l2tp туннеля
Добавлено: 2011-03-12 18:23:01
sergey2140
schizoid писал(а):а зачем то 2 l2tp туннеля? чем один слушая все интерфесы не устроит?
ложиться один канал, пусть клиент подключается на второй...
Очень удобно, не нужно заморачиваться с балансировкой канала и NATом. По одному каналу через туннель ходит одна локалка на сервер, по другому - другая. Маршрутизацию настроил, в файрволе лишних отрубил - и готово.